// Fig. 5.5: Sum.java,,
// Counter-controlled repetition with the for structure,,
,,
// Java extension packages,,
import javax.swing.JOptionPane;,,
,,
public class Sum {,,
,,
// main method begins execution of Java application,,
public static void main( String args[] ),,
{,,
int sum = 0;,,
,,
// sum even integers from 2 through 100,,
for ( int number = 2; number <= 100; number += 2 ),,
sum += number;,,
,,
// display results,,
JOptionPane.showMessageDialog( null," ""The sum is "" + sum",
" ""Sum Even Integers from 2 to 100,
JOptionPane.INFORMATION_MESSAGE );
System.exit( 0 ); // terminate the application
} // end method main
} // end class Sum
